11问答网
所有问题
利用单片机中的定时器实现在P1.0和P1.7引脚上分别输出100Hz和50Hz的方波信号 用c语言
如题所述
举报该问题
其他回答
第1个回答 2017-06-09
#include<reg51.h>
sbit p10=P1^0;
sbit p17=P1^7;
unsigned char tt=0;
void t0isr() interrupt 1
{
tt++;
if(tt==20)p10=~p10;
if(tt>=40){p17=~p17;tt=0;}
}
main()
{
TMOD=0x02;
TH0=6;
TL0=6;
ET0=1;
TR0=1;
EA=1;
while(1);
}
本回答被网友采纳
第2个回答 2017-06-09
才¥0.2
相似回答
单片机的
题目
答:
输出100Hz方波
,应该每隔5ms,对P1.7取反一次即可。
输出50Hz方波
,应该每隔10ms,对P1.6取反一次即可,可以只是
在P1.7
为0的时候,取反P1.6 ORG 0000H SJMP START ORG 000BH SJMP T0_INT START:MOV TMOD, #01H ;T0定时方式1 MOV TH0, #0ECH ;5ms MOV TL...
大家正在搜
51单片机定时器的原理与使用
单片机定时器有什么用
单片机定时器怎么使用
51单片机有几个定时器
51单片机定时器原理
定时器单片机
单片机定时器程序
单片机定时器模式
51单片机的CPU结构
相关问题
单片机 利用定时器t0定时,从p1.7引脚输出频率为1khz...
用单片机内部定时器T0在P1.0的引脚产生频率为100HZ的...
利用定时器t0定时,从p1.7引脚输出频率为1khz的方波
用汇编语言编写程序,用定时器T1中断方式实现在P1.2管脚上...
利用单片机的定时器t0工作于方式1,实现从p1.0引脚上输出...
某单片机的时钟频率是6mhz,试利用t0定时在p1.2引脚输...
单片机的定时器T0产生50HZ的方波由P1.0输出此方波
51单片机晶振频率为12MHz,利用中断在P1.1口输出50...